STUFFED ITALIAN BREAD RECIPE | ALLRECIPES
An easy way to dress up a plain loaf of bread! Great as an appetizer or as a side dish to grilled steaks. My local grocery sells a blend of mozzarella and provolone cheese that I use.
Provided by Beth Goldsmith
Categories Appetizers and Snacks Garlic Bread Recipes
Total Time 40 minutes
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Yield 10 servings
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- Mix melted butter, parsley, olive oil, and garlic together in a bowl.
- Slice bread diagonally without cutting all the way through; do the same on the opposite diagonal to create cube-shaped sections still attached to the bottom crust.
- Spoon butter mixture carefully between sections; stuff in shredded Italian cheese blend. Wrap loaf in aluminum foil.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 15 minutes; unwrap and bake until cheese is melted, about 10 minutes more.

STUFFED SOURDOUGH LOAF RECIPE | ALLRECIPES
This loaf stuffed with four cheeses and artichoke hearts will be popular at any party!
Provided by Rebecca Swift
Categories Appetizers and Snacks Canapes and Crostini Recipes
Total Time 30 minutes
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Yield 24 servings
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Preheat the broiler.
- Cut the sourdough loaf in half and scoop out the bread.
- In a medium saucepan over medium heat, melt the butter and mix together the scooped out bread pieces and garlic. Slowly cook and stir 10 minutes, or until the bread is browned. Transfer to a large bowl.
- In the bowl with the bread mixture, mix the Monterey Jack cheese, cream cheese, Parmesan cheese and artichoke hearts. Spoon the mixture into the hollowed bread shell. Top with Cheddar cheese.
- Broil 5 minutes, or until the bread is lightly brown and the cheeses are melted. Remove from oven and sprinkle with green onions. Slice and serve.

CHEESEBURGER STUFFED BREAD LOAF RECIPE: HOW TO MAKE IT
From tasteofhome.com
Total Time 50 minutes
Category Lunch
Calories per serving
- In a skillet, cook beef over medium heat until no longer pink; drain. Add onion, cheeses, ketchup, 1/2 teaspoon salt and pepper; set aside. In a bowl, combine the flour, baking powder and remaining salt. Cut in shortening until mixture resembles coarse crumbs. Using a fork, stir in milk until mixture forms a ball. On a floured surface, roll out dough into a 15x10-in. rectangle. Spread meat mixture to within 1 in. of edges. Roll up, jelly-roll style, starting with a long side. Pinch edges to seal. Place seam side down on an ungreased baking sheet. Bake at 425° for 30 minutes or until golden brown. Cut into slices.
